ELAV and FNE Determine Neuronal Transcript Signatures through EXon-Activated Rescue

Carrasco et  al. show that the two neuron-specific RNA-binding proteins ELAV and FNE define the unique identity of neuronal messenger RNAs. When not repressed by ELAV, FNE undergoes a functional switch and rescues neuronal 3′ end processing and splicing in a process termed exon-activated functional rescue.
